From d6d049d5e0c20ec64526d74dbe8aede4f7444c0d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: GImbrailo Date: Mon, 11 Aug 2025 13:19:06 -0700 Subject: [PATCH 1/2] docs(README): update README to provide comprehensive information about Tezos Key Generation API, including features, architecture, quick start guide, configuration, API endpoints, use cases, and troubleshooting tips --- README.md | 160 +++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++- 1 file changed, 157 insertions(+), 3 deletions(-) diff --git a/README.md b/README.md index dd7c066..4d5f855 100644 --- a/README.md +++ b/README.md @@ -1,6 +1,160 @@ -Keygen is a tool for creating keys to be used with Teaquito Integration tests +# Tezos Key Generation API -# Docker: +A high-performance, Redis-backed API service for generating and managing Tezos cryptographic keys for integration testing and development environments. +## What It Does -# Local Hosting \ No newline at end of file +The Tezos Key Generation API provides: + +- **Automated Key Generation**: Creates batches of Tezos keys (secret/public key pairs) on demand +- **Key Pool Management**: Maintains pools of pre-generated keys for fast access +- **Multi-Network Support**: Supports multiple Tezos networks (ghostnet, rionet, seoulnet) +- **Ephemeral Keys**: Temporary keys with configurable expiration for testing +- **Funding Integration**: Automatically funds generated addresses with specified amounts +- **Redis Backend**: Fast, persistent storage for key management + +## Architecture + +``` +┌─────────────────┐ ┌─────────────────┐ ┌─────────────────┐ +│ API Client │ │ Key Generation │ │ Redis Store │ +│ │◄──►│ Service │◄──►│ │ +│ (HTTP/REST) │ │ │ │ (Key Pools) │ +└─────────────────┘ └─────────────────┘ └─────────────────┘ + │ │ │ + │ │ │ + ▼ ▼ ▼ +┌─────────────────┐ ┌─────────────────┐ ┌─────────────────┐ +│ Tezos RPC │ │ Remote Signer │ │ Metrics & │ +│ (Network) │ │ (Signatory) │ │ Monitoring │ +└─────────────────┘ └─────────────────┘ └─────────────────┘ +``` + +## Quick Start + +### Using Docker (Recommended) + +```bash +# Pull the latest image +docker pull ghcr.io/ecadlabs/tezos-key-gen-api:latest + +# Run with basic configuration +docker run -d \ + --name keygen \ + -p 3000:3000 \ + -p 3001:3001 \ + -e REDIS_HOST=localhost \ + -e REDIS_PASSWORD=password123 \ + ghcr.io/ecadlabs/tezos-key-gen-api:latest +``` + +### Local Development + +```bash +# Install dependencies +npm install + +# Build the project +npm run build + +# Start the service +npm start +``` + +## Configuration + +### Environment Variables + +| Variable | Default | Description | +|----------|---------|-------------| +| `REDIS_HOST` | `localhost` | Redis server hostname | +| `REDIS_PORT` | `6379` | Redis server port | +| `REDIS_PASSWORD` | `password123` | Redis authentication password | +| `RPC_URL` | `https://ghostnet.ecadinfra.com` | Default Tezos RPC endpoint | +| `TARGET_BUFFER` | `100` | Target number of keys in pool | +| `BATCH_SIZE` | `20` | Number of keys to generate per batch | +| `FUNDING_AMOUNT` | `10` | Amount in tez to fund each address | + +### Configuration Files + +- **`pools-config.json`**: Network-specific pool configurations +- **`accounts-config.json`**: User account and network mappings +- **`ephemeral-config.json`**: Ephemeral key settings + +## API Endpoints + +### Key Management + +- `POST /{network}` - Get a key from the pool (e.g., `POST /ghostnet`) +- `GET /{network}` - Get pool status and funding balance +- `POST /{network}/ephemeral` - Create a new ephemeral key +- `GET /{network}/ephemeral/{id}/keys/{key}` - Get ephemeral key details +- `POST /{network}/ephemeral/{id}/keys/{key}` - Sign data with ephemeral key + +### Metrics + +- `GET /metrics` - Prometheus metrics endpoint (port 3001) + +### Authentication + +All endpoints require Bearer token authentication: +```bash +curl -H "Authorization: Bearer taquito-example" \ + http://localhost:3000/ghostnet +``` + +## Supported Networks + +- **Ghostnet**: `https://ghostnet.ecadinfra.com` +- **Rionet**: `http://ecad-tezos-rionet-rolling-1.i.ecadinfra.com` +- **Seoulnet**: `http://ecad-tezos-seoulnet-rolling-1.i.ecadinfra.com` + +## Use Cases + +- **Integration Testing**: Generate test keys for Tezos application testing +- **Development**: Create development wallets and addresses +- **QA Environments**: Provision test accounts with funding +- **Load Testing**: Generate large numbers of keys for performance testing + +## Monitoring + +The service exposes Prometheus metrics on port 3001: + +- Key pool sizes +- Keys produced/issued counters +- Funding account balances +- HTTP request metrics + +## Troubleshooting + +### Common Issues + +1. **Redis Connection Failures** + - Ensure Redis is running and accessible + - Check network connectivity between containers + - Verify Redis credentials + +2. **Key Generation Failures** + - Check Tezos RPC endpoint accessibility + - Verify remote signer (Signatory) is running + - Ensure sufficient funding account balance + +3. **Authentication Errors** + - Verify Bearer token is valid + - Check user account configuration in `accounts-config.json` + +### Logs + +Enable debug logging by setting log level to `debug` in your environment. + +## Contributing + +1.
